In Scandinavia we use air to air heat pumps. We generally don't have central heating of any kind so we aren't so tempted to try to shoehorn the heat pump into a system based on hot water. Air to air is much cheaper and is more efficient because it doesn't need to raise the temperature of the working fluid so much and doesn't require a big fluid to water heat exchanger. It's two parts, the compressor in a box with a big fan on the outside and a box on the wall indoors containing a refrigerant to air heat exchanger and a fan. The two are connected by pipes, typically three or four metres long, containing the refrigerant. So yes, air-to-refrigerant-to-air. > Kinda how we don't use toxic ammonia as a refrigerant. Ammonia is definitely still used as a refrigerant, just not in consumer equipment. It’s commonly used for ice rink chillers, at least in the US and Canada. Not sure about Europe.
